Dear Commissioners:
This request for a recorded exemption is submitted by Household Bank, F.S.B. c/o
Burl Van Buskirk. The parcel of land is described as part of the N 1/2 of the
NW 1/4 of Section 32, T2N, R66W of the 6th P.M. , Weld County, Colorado. The
property is located north of the City of Fort Lupton, east of Denver Avenue,
south of Weld County Road 16. This request is to divide a 1.35 acre parcel of
land, which is the total contiguous landholdings of the applicant, into two lots
of .72 acres and .62 acres, more or less.
The applicants propose using two commercial exempt wells as the water sources.
Septic systems will provide sewage disposal. The City of Fort Lupton has no
objections to this proposal.
It is the opinion of the Department of Planning Services' staff that this request
should be denied. The applicant has failed to show that the proposed lots will
have access to a means for the disposal of sewage in compliance with the
requirements of the Weld County Health Department. Wes Potter, Director, Weld
County Environmental Protection Services, has stated in his May 10 referral
response that it is the policy of his division not to recommend approval of any
lot size less than one acre, which will utilize an Individual Sewage Disposal
System.
910494
May 30, 1991
Page 2
The applicant has failed to demonstrate that the proposed lots will have access
to an adequate water supply. The commercial exempt well permits, which would
be issued if this division was approved, limit the use of the wells to drinking
and sanitary use inside one commercial business. Outside use for irrigation is
prohibited. Weld County' s site plan review criteria requires at least 15% of
each commercial or industrial lot to be landscaped. The limitations on the
commercial exempt well permits may make it impossible for the landscaping
standards to be met.
The staff requests that the Board of County Commissioners consider the
application and determine if the Standards of Section 9-2 E. (1) (a) through (m)
of the Weld County Subdivision Regulations have been met.

Dear Ms. Swanson:
We have reviewed the above referenced proposal to split a 1 .35 acre
parcel which currently contains two commercial buildings into two lots, one
for each building. The application materials indicate that this property has
not been involved in any subdivision since 1972. The proposed water supply is
to be individual on-lot wells.
The application indicates that there are three wells on the property, one
is registered and the other two are unregistered. Permit Number 13013-R
issued to Herman Appel appears to be the registered well at this location.
This well was permitted in 1960 for irrigation purposes. It does not appear
as though any of the wells have an historic use which would allow them to be
late registered for the current commercial use.
Since the 1 .35 acre lot appears to have been created prior to 1972, we
may be able to issue a small capacity commercial well permit for each lot
after the split is approved. The availability of a well permit and our
recommendation for approval is subject to the following conditions:
1. The property has not been previously subdivided or exempted since
1972. We consider this a one-time exemption and will not make
additional permits available for future splits of either lot.
2. The well permit which will be available will limit well use to
drinking and sanitary use inside one commercial business. Outside
use for irrigation is prohibited. If an existing well can provide a
satisfactory supply, it can be utilized as the well used under the
new permit. Plat notes and covenants should reflect the limitation
on use of the wells.
3. The permitted well must be the only well on each newly created lot.
Any existing well which is not permitted and utilized must be
properly plugged and abandoned.
Ms. Lanell J. Swanson Page 2
May 21, 1991
4. The applicant should provide proof that an evaporative wastewater
system will not be required. We could not issue the well permit if
any evaporative system is required.
5. Prospective lot purchasers should be made aware of the limitations on
water use and other information contained in this letter. We
recommend that a copy of this letter be given to lot purchasers and
submitted with the well permit application.

Dear Commissioners:
I'm writing regarding the response to the above captioned Recorded
Exemption by the Weld County Department of Planning Services. Our firm,
J.L. Sears and Associates, represents the owner/applicant which is
Household Bank , f .s.b. whose office is located in Illinois and who
acquired this property through foreclosure action . When the property
was originally improved it was under common ownership , but was developed
as two separate business facilities which are fenced separately and
appear to be individual tracts. In order for the owner to effect a sale
of the property, practicality dictates that the 2 buildings be legally
separated.
The Department of Planning has recommended denial based upon a memo from
the Weld County Health Department which indicates that they do not
recommend approval for parcels of less than one acre . This policy may
have merit for new construction , however the buildings on this parcel
are already operating under existing septic systems that have been •
operational since pre-1957 and 1980 respectively with no problems. I
refer you to a plat prepared by Alpha Engineering of Fort Lupton that
shows the existing systems and which also demonstrates adequate area for
expansion or replacement of the systems if and when that should become
necessary. I also refer you to a letter to the Department of Planning
from Alpha Engineering which states that there exists adequate room for
expansion and also explains that the distance to an existing sewer line
is in excess of 1 ,700 feet and would require a lift station , malting this
option cost prohibitive, particularly in light of the fact that
existing, working systems are already in place .
The second concern of the Planning Staff involves the water wells.
There already exists one well which currently serves both proposed
sites. The Division of Water Resources has indicated in a letter of Nay
21 , 1991 that a well permit would be made available for each site
providing that their conditions be met. The conditions are as follows:
1 . That the recorded exemption be approved by Weld County.
2. That the proposed wells limit use to indoor uses, which prohibits
outside irrigation.
3. That newly permitted wells are the only wells on the site.
4. That an evaporative wastewater system is not utilized.
5. That prospective purchasers be made aware of any limitations.
page 1
303/857-2930 - 303/629-0432 - 303/785-2291 ale LI:a^�*
140 DENVER AVENUE-FORT LUPTON,COLORADO 80621
We feel that all the above conditions have been or can be met. The
Planning Staff's concern is that the water supply will be inadequate due
to the limitation to indoor use. As before, with new construction this
may be a concern . However, the existing buildings have limited existing
landscaping due to extensive concrete and paving on the highway frontage
side . The north building has the bulk of existing landscaping and has
been vacant and without irrigation for approximately 2 years with the
only visible needs being the mowing of some weeds that have grown.
Existing landscaping consists primarily of native trees that will likely
survive without irrigation. A reasonable option would be to replace the
existing landscaping with plants chosen under a xeriscaping plan with
species that can survive without irrigation or a complete changeover to
rock or other non-water using forms. Any future owner would most
certainly be willing and able to live with the indoor use requirement .
We feel that a site-plan review should not be necessary since these are
existing buildings whose use is not being changed.
We also would like to address the fact that by selling these sites to
businesses that wish to locate to Weld County, the benefits of tax
revenues and buildings in use rather than vacant are extremely important
to the continued economic viability of south Weld County.
We believe that the concerns of the Planning Staff can be adequately
addressed and we respectfully request that the Board of Commissioners
approve this recorded exemption.

Dear Ms. Swanson:
I have reviewed the referenced property with regard to the use of
separate septic systems for lots "A" and "B" should this poroperty
be subdivided.
The proposed subdivision would produce a lot size of 0. 65 acres for
lot "A" and 0. 70 acres for lot "B" . Lot "A" has an open area
behind the existing building of approximately 200 feet by 81 feet,
and lot "B" has an open area behind the building of approximately
160 feet by 94 feet. In both cases the areas behind the building are
accessible from Denver Avenue for system maintenance, and the open
areas provide ample room for system expansion. Also, the nearest
sanitary sewer line is located at 14th Street and Denver Avenue, a
distance of over 1 , 700 feet uphill which would require a lift
station to transport sewerage to the main line.
Because there is room on these properties for the existing separate
septic systems and because there would be prohibitive expense
involved in connecting these properties to the public sewer system,
I feel that the most feasible way to meet the sanitary needs of
these properties would be by using individual sewage disposal
systems.
